Chamberlain challenges Govt on DFID-FCO merger

18 Jun 2020

Today Wendy Chamberlain, Liberal Democrat International Development Spokesperson, will ask an Urgent Question in the House of Commons on the merger of the Department of International Development with the Foreign and Commonwealth Office.

Wendy Chamberlain MP
  • Just two months ago the Secretary of State for International Development stated that having a separate department to the Foreign Office was important for both our global leadership, as well as our efforts to reduce poverty around the world. Either the Secretary knowingly misled the Committee, was kept in the dark by her colleagues or this is a publicity stunt, will little thought or care put to the consequences.
  • UK aid prevents suffering. But with it taking the Government to be dragged kicking and screaming to u-turn on their refusal to back free school meals over the summer holidays, their callousness evidently spans across Whitehall.
  • The Liberal Democrats have always maintained our support for the UK's role as a world leader in providing aid to those most in need. By working on an international scale we can achieve so much more than we can on our own.
  • This decision does not reflect 'Global Britain', but a Government determined to see the UK turn its back on the world.
